A New Lens on Medicine: How AI Is Transforming Patient Care
In the realm of healthcare, every second counts and every detail matters. With mountains of medical data growing larger by the day, even the most skilled physicians face the challenge of processing information quickly while making life-changing decisions. Enter artificial intelligence—not as a replacement for doctors, but as a powerful ally in the quest for better, faster, and more precise care.
One of the most promising applications of AI in medicine lies in its ability to analyze vast amounts of medical data with superhuman speed. From medical imaging and genomic sequencing to electronic health records, AI algorithms can detect subtle patterns that might escape the human eye. The result? Diseases are being identified earlier—sometimes years before symptoms appear—giving patients and doctors a critical head start.
Across the globe, hospitals and research institutions are integrating AI into daily practice. Radiologists are using AI to flag suspicious findings on scans, oncologists are leveraging predictive models to personalize cancer treatments, and researchers are accelerating drug discovery at unprecedented rates. Rather than working in isolation, AI is functioning as a decision-support tool—helping doctors confirm diagnoses, reduce errors, and focus more time on direct patient care.
The impact extends beyond individual cases. By improving both speed and accuracy, AI has the potential to reduce waiting times, lower healthcare costs, and bring expert-level insights to underserved communities where specialists may be scarce.
Of course, technology alone cannot replace the compassion, intuition, and human connection that lie at the heart of medicine. But as a partner to clinicians, AI is proving to be an invaluable asset—helping to ensure that when it comes to saving lives, nothing is missed.
